Above & Beyond Honoree Mike Tinoco on Love, Learning, and Belonging
What happens when a teacher refuses to define students by their shortcomings?
In this first episode of Teacher Stories' new partnership with Above & Beyond Teaching, Ken Futernick talks with 2024 Above & Beyond honoree Mike Tinoco, an English and journalism teacher from San Jose whose impact extends far beyond the classroom. Mike shares how his own struggles in school shaped his commitment to seeing every student’s potential—especially those others might overlook.
Former student Chris Hernandez arrived in Mike’s classroom gang-involved, frequently in trouble, and disengaged from school. Today, he credits Mike with helping him imagine a future he never thought possible. Along the way, Mike explains why unconditional care, meaningful relationships, and a sense of community matter more than any lesson plan.
This is a powerful conversation about belonging, second chances, and the quiet ways teachers change lives—often without ever knowing the full impact of their work.
